The Importance of Regular Wheel Alignment Checks for Your Chevy

A wheel alignment involves making precise mechanical adjustments to your Chevy's suspension system to position the wheels correctly. When your wheels are accurately aligned at your Chevy dealer, your wheels will be centered, and your tires will make proper contact with the road, ensuring optimal vehicle performance, comfort, safety, and fuel efficiency. more Handling The correct alignment of your wheels ensures that your tires wear evenly and that your Chevy's weight is equally distributed across all four tires. This will give your tires traction and significantly improve your vehicle's handling, particularly when navigating curves or making more rapid turns. Control When your Chevy's wheels are correctly aligned, your vehicle will respond accurately to steering inputs, allowing you to maintain complete control. Proper alignment will also prevent your car from drifting, especially when driving at high speeds or in inclement weather. Comfort Misaligned wheels can cause steering wheel vibrations, making driving your vehicle far less enjoyable. However, when your Chevy's wheels are correctly aligned, uncomfortable vibrations are reduced, making your driving experience much smoother. Safety Proper alignment enhances your safety on the road by minimizing the risk of losing control of your vehicle, especially during sudden maneuvers. Misalignment can significantly impact your vehicle's braking system by causing uneven pressure on the brake pads, resulting in poor braking ability. Fuel Efficiency Misaligned wheels create friction and resistance, causing your engine to exert more effort, directly resulting in higher fuel consumption. The correct alignment of your wheels minimizes rolling resistance, enhancing your vehicle's fuel efficiency and helping you save money on fuel expenses. Tire Life Improperly aligned wheels lead to uneven tire wear, which can significantly shorten the life of your tires. When the suspension is misaligned, your vehicle's tires will make irregular contact with the road, increasing resistance between the tire and the road surface. This causes certain areas of the tires to wear down more quickly than others, resulting in earlier tire replacement. Correct alignment helps distribute the vehicle's weight evenly over the tires, ensuring uniform wear, reducing wear, and prolonging the life of your tires. Repair Costs Proper alignment not only saves you money on tires, it also minimizes mechanical problems by reducing the strain on suspension and steering components that can cause premature wear. Having your Chevrolet technician regularly check your Chevy's alignment will help you avoid unexpected and costly repairs. Maintaining the correct alignment optimizes your driving experience by improving handling, control, and comfort and your Chevy's overall performance. Oil Change Frequency: How Often Does Your Chevy Need One?

Regular oil changes are one of the most basic pieces of maintenance you can perform for your car. How often should you head to the Chevy dealer to change your oil? It's actually not that complicated. more When Should You Change Your Oil? The best place to start? Your Chevy's owner's manual. It's tailored to your specific model and engine, providing the most accurate information. Typically, newer models with synthetic oil can go about 7,500 miles between changes. Always check your manual to be sure. Driving conditions matter, too. Think about how and where you drive. If you're often in stop-and-go traffic, driving in extreme temperatures, or hitting dusty roads, your car falls into the "severe" use category. This scenario usually means you should change your oil more frequently. Why Bother Changing Your Oil? It Keeps Things Smooth Oil keeps your engine's moving parts gliding smoothly against each other, which helps prevent them from wearing out too quickly. If you fall behind on changes, the oil gets old and grimy, which isn't slick enough to prevent friction, leading to faster wear and potential engine damage. It Cleans the Engine As oil circulates, it picks up tiny bits of debris and dirt from the engine. These are normally caught by the oil filter, but over time, the filter gets full and becomes less effective. Regularly changing your oil and filter helps clean out these particles and stops sludge from building up in your engine. It Saves on Gas A well-lubricated engine doesn't have to work as hard, which means it uses fuel more efficiently. Keeping your oil fresh can actually help you get better mileage, saving you money at the pump and being a bit kinder to the environment. Signs It's Time for an Oil Change From the Chevy Dealer Your Oil Looks Nasty Fresh oil is usually a clear amber color. Pull out the dipstick and check it: if your oil is dark and dirty, it's time for a change. You should check your oil at least once a month to be sure it's still doing okay. Too Much Engine Noise Old oil can cause your engine to make more noise than usual. If things are sounding rough under the hood, like clattering or knocking, your oil probably isn't doing its job anymore. That Little Light on Your Dash Appears Many new Chevys have an oil life monitoring system. If the oil light comes on, don't ignore it. This system is pretty smart and calculates when you need fresh oil based on how you actually use your car. There's Smoke Coming From the Exhaust Is your car's exhaust looking more like smoke? It could be a sign that old oil is burning off inside your engine, which definitely isn't good. Changing your oil is one of the simplest ways to avoid bigger, more expensive problems down the road. Chevy Transmission Care: Ensuring Smooth Gear Shifts

​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​​Your Chevy transmission takes the energy produced by the engine and uses a series of gears to channel this energy to the wheels to enable them to move your car at the desired speed. The transmission is a very complex piece of engineering, and it requires regular services to allow it to always work at its best. These are a few signs that you need to visit your friendly Chevy dealer for a transmission service. more Strange Noises A healthy transmission doesn't make any loud sound as it shifts gears, so if you hear sounds from the transmission, the noises are a warning that something is wrong. The most common sound is a slight buzzing noise that will gradually grow louder until it becomes noticeable. You might also hear odd humming or whining sounds. Odd sounds could be due to worn or damaged components, or the transmission might lack transmission fluid. We'll need to examine your transmission to identify the cause of the noises. Fortunately, if you visit us as soon as you hear any sounds from the transmission, we can usually quickly and inexpensively repair their cause. Leaking Fluid A pool of bright or dark red liquid under your Chevy is a sure sign of a transmission fluid leak. This fluid provides the hydraulic power that allows the gears to move. It also provides friction resistance to numerous transmission components, which reduces potential damage. In addition, the fluid helps to cool the components and prevent the transmission from overheating. We don't advise driving if your transmission is leaking, as this could cause serious and irreparable damage to its components. Our technicians will search for the cause of the leak, and one of the most common leak sites is a worn transmission pan gasket. Once we've identified the site of the leak, we'll fix it and then replace the lost fluid. Transmission Slipping Slipping is a disturbing situation where your transmission will shift into another gear without warning. You'll probably hear a variety of metal-on-metal noises and also experience a reduction in power as the new gear engages. In most cases, the gears will change to the previous gear setting, and this can lead to an accident, for example, if the gears shift to Park. This problem could be due to worn or damaged gear teeth, a lack of transmission fluid, or even an error in the transmission computer. We'll investigate and repair the issue. We'll also examine your transmission for any damage caused by the slipping, so we can repair or replace damaged parts and ensure your transmission is in perfect condition. Unmatched Capability: The 2024 Chevy Silverado 3500 HD

Having a heavy-duty pickup truck can make even the toughest workdays easier. The 2024 Chevy Silverado 3500 HD is a perfect work truck, with new safety functions and enhanced capabilities. Take a closer look at the new Silverado 3500 HD in this complete guide to its features. more Engine Options The new Silverado 3500 HD comes with a 6.6L V8 gas engine. This engine is paired with an Allison 10-speed automatic transmission and offers 401 horsepower with 464 lb.-ft. of torque. There's an available 6.6L Duramax Turbo-Diesel V8 engine for increased performance in the Silverado 3500 HD. This engine is also paired with an Allison 10-speed automatic transmission, but it delivers 470 horsepower and 975 lb.-ft. of torque. Work Capabilities With the 6.6L Duramax Turbo-Diesel engine, your new Chevy Silverado 3500 HD has a maximum towing capacity of up to 36,000 pounds. The Chevy Trailering Package makes towing simple with a combination of features, including the trailer hitch, trailing hitch platform, 7-wire electrical harness, and 7-pin sealed connector. The assistive Hitch Guidance function uses cameras and sensors to give you a clear view of your hitch and trailer for more precise trailering. Certain available features make jobs even easier, such as cargo bed LED lighting, which illuminates your truck bed in the dark. The available Multi-Flex Tailgate has six different functions, one of which turns your tailgate into a step for climbing in and out of the cargo bed. Entertainment Features The 2024 Silverado 3500 HD has a Chevrolet Infotainment System with a color touchscreen. Chevrolet Infotainment 3 offers Bluetooth audio streaming, Apple CarPlay, Android Auto, and GPS navigation. For a more personalized experience, you can sync your compatible smartphone for hands-free phone calls and texting. Google Built-In comes standard on the LT and higher trims, giving you access to Google Maps, Google Play, and Google Assistant. These features can elevate any car ride by letting you play your favorite music, look up interesting attractions, and even schedule appointments. Safety Functions A combination of assistive driving features helps create a safer ride in the 2024 Silverado 3500 HD. These include Automatic Emergency Braking, Buckle to Drive, Following Distance Indicator, Forward Collision Alert, Front Pedestrian Braking, and Lane Departure Warning. When used responsibly, these features reduce the risk of collisions with other vehicles and pedestrians. OnStar Connected Services capability makes it easier to get help during emergencies behind the wheel, such as accidents or medical concerns. 5 Electrical Problems You Should Always Fix at Your Chevy Dealer

Your car has a complex electrical system. When there are problems with any part of this electrical system, it can cause major performance issues with the vehicle. These electrical problems should always be repaired by a mechanic at the Chevy dealer, as dealership mechanics are highly qualified to tackle these repairs. more 1. A Dead Battery Determining the culprit behind a dead battery is a must. If the battery itself is faulty, then you may be able to jumpstart it so you can drive to the dealership for a battery replacement. If another component of your electrical system is making the battery seem like it's dead, then you may not be able to jumpstart the car, and your mechanic will have to investigate to determine the cause of the problem. 2. A Faulty Alternator When your alternator is in disrepair, you may notice dim headlights or deal with frequent stalling. These problems are typically caused by the battery not being fully charged, as a broken alternator can't charge the battery sufficiently. Inspect the alternator regularly to make sure the belt isn't damaged, as a damaged or loose belt can stop the alternator from working properly. The belt should be replaced at your dealership when needed, and other parts of the alternator will need to be repaired or replaced by the mechanic at the dealership when they're faulty, too. 3. A Broken Starter Motor If your vehicle makes a clicking noise but doesn't start, then it typically means your starter mortar is broken. Alternatively, an oil leak or wiring issues could be causing the problems with your starter motor. Every starter motor-related issue should be addressed at the dealership, and your dealer can give you advice on how to maintain your starter motor to help prevent it from breaking down. 4. A Bad Fuse or Fuse Box When a single fuse in your vehicle blows, it typically only affects one component of the vehicle. For example, if the fuse connected to your stereo blows, then the stereo won't work, but the other parts of your electrical system will be fine. If multiple fuses blow, then multiple parts will be affected. If fuses blow often, then you may have a problem with your fuse box, so it might need to be replaced. 5. A Problem With Your Wiring Malfunctioning wiring can cause problems with numerous parts of your electrical system. You may have trouble starting the car, notice your headlights are flickering, or notice that fuses are blowing frequently. Your wiring should be inspected regularly. 5 Impressive Features of the 2024 Chevy Camaro

The 2024 Chevy Camaro is giving enthusiasts a lot to get excited about. As a Chevy dealer, we love seeing drivers discover the available 650 horsepower, beautiful Collector's Edition, and modern technology. Read on for a closer look at a few of our favorite features of the 2024 Camaro. more 1. The Three Powertrains Chevrolet has designed three powerful engine options for the 2024 Camaro. The standard engine option generates 335 horsepower using a powerful V6 engine. From there, you can choose to upgrade to a 6.2-liter V8, which generates 455 horsepower. Chevrolet's third option generates up to 650 horsepower. It does this using a 6.2-liter supercharged V8 engine. In the Zl1 Coupe, when paired with the available 10-speed paddle-shift automatic transmission, the Camaro goes from 0 to 60 in 3.5 seconds. 2. The Collector Edition Camaro enthusiasts will want to consider the meaningful Collector Edition. This package option celebrates 2024 as the final year for the sixth-generation Camaro. When this package is added to the LT, LT1, or the SS trim, it adds a unique Panther Black Metallic Tintcoat with a black center stripe to the car. Every trim that adds this package comes away with an exclusive exterior badge, as well as a steering wheel badge. There is also a unique logo on the floor mats and spoiler stripe. Additionally, vehicles with Black wheels will get black lug nuts. Vehicles with polished wheels will get a silver Camaro logo on the wheel center caps. 3. The Comfortable Driver's Seat Your front passenger will enjoy a standard six-way power seat for a comfortable ride. In the driver's seat, you'll always be able to get your settings just the way you want them in your eight-way power seat. Once you do, you can save the settings for your seat and outside mirrors using the available memory settings. These are available for up to two drivers. 4. The Exceptional Infotainment System Chevrolet added a seven-inch color touchscreen complete with wireless Android Auto and wireless Apple CarPlay as standard. These integrations make it easy for you to connect your smartphone and use your familiar apps. You'll also be able to wirelessly connect your phone using Bluetooth technology. Your Camaro's system will allow you to connect up to two devices at once using Bluetooth, making it easy for everyone to stream their favorite audio. There's an available eight-inch HD color touchscreen. This upgrade also adds excellent in-vehicle apps and cloud-connected personalization. 5. The Rear Vision Camera You'll have a great view of what's behind you with this feature. When you're driving in reverse, your touchscreen will show you an image of the area behind your Camaro. Introducing the 2024 Chevy Silverado 2500

Heavy-duty engine output and towing strength meet sophisticated luxuries in the 2024 Chevy Silverado 2500. This reliable pickup is now available here at your local Chevy dealer. more Engines and Capabilities While this edition comes with two 6.6-liter V8 engine options for you to choose from, one is a gas engine and the other is a turbocharged diesel variant. The gas engine produces 401 horsepower and 464 pound-feet of torque, giving it an impressive 3,689-pound maximum payload rating and an 18,700-pound tow rating. The diesel variant takes things up a notch by generating 470 horsepower, 975 pound-feet of torque, a max 3,613-pound payload rating, and 21,600 pounds of towing strength. Both engines can be paired with an available four-wheel drive powertrain, and if needed, versatility can be increased even more with the optional automatic-locking rear differential, a readily adaptable off-road suspension system, and other terrain-tackling enhancements. Cabin Comforts and Design With room for up to six passengers, you have plenty of space to relax inside this pickup's cabin, as well many features to help accommodate, like the heated and ventilated multi-adjustable front-row seats and heated rear seats. The dual-zone climate control and rear air vents add to this, while a wide array of fabric choices is available for the seats, including perforated leather in different color options. The Multi-Flex Tailgate outside can be used as a step, as a convenient work surface, or as a secure way of keeping longer cargo in the bed with its many load stop functions. The Alaskan snowplow add-on is sure to be appreciated in colder climates, the vertical trailer tow mirrors provide more expansive views of both the truck and trailers, and the power sunroof opens seamlessly with the push of a button. Tech and Driver Assistance Sophisticated technology highlights offered include the Chevrolet Infotainment 3 Premium System, which lets you use either a 13.4-inch full-color touchscreen display or your voice to control many of its entertainment and navigation functions, and the HD Surround Vision camera system with its 360-degree visuals. There's also a Head-Up Display for the windshield and a premium Bose sound system that provides concert-like audio experiences. Making lane changes safer, Lane Alert with Side Blind Zone Alert notifies you when other vehicles are driving nearby, while Forward Collision Alert does the same to help prevent frontal collisions. Automatic Emergency Braking can then help you stop when seconds count, and Rear Cross Traffic Alert makes backing out into cross streets or parking lanes easier.
